Shime-Kazari (Hatsu-hinode) hawk a traditional symbol of goodDescription Embrace the essential Japanese New Year tradition with our Shimekazari, crafted from washi paper. Shimekazari, a symbolic rope decoration, serves as a marker for the descent of the Toshigami sama (New Year deities) and denotes a sacred space to welcome them, celebrating the family's well being and prosperity.
